Describe the causes of Weathering and Erosion here: (image 1 with grass)
ArbitrLikvidat [17]

Answer:

(image 1) Weathering breaks down the Earth's surface into smaller pieces. Those pieces are moved in a process called erosion, and deposited somewhere else. Weathering can be caused by wind, water, ice, plants, gravity, and changes in temperature. As waves attack the shore, headlands are eroded, producing steep sea cliffs. The waves vigorously attack the portion of the cliff near sea level where joints, fissures, and softer strata are especially vulnerable. The cliffs are undermined and caves are formed. The three main forces that cause erosion are water, wind, and ice. Water is the main cause of erosion on Earth. Although water may not seem powerful at first, it is one of the most powerful forces on the planet.

When is cytokineses complete
noname [10]

Cytokineses completes in telophase.

<u>Explanation:</u>

cytokinesis is the process by which the cell cycle takes place by dividing the cytoplasm. In a cell, mitosis is always accompanied by cytokinesis In a typical cell,  although in some cells like  Drosophila embryosand vertebrate osteoclasts mitosis takes place without the process of cytokinesis. Cytokinesis usually starts in anaphase and completes in telophase, thereby reaching completion and there is a begging of next phase called interphase.

Telophase is the last completed stage of mitosis. The name is derived from latin word telos which means end. At this phase the sister chromatids will be reaching the opposite poles.  the dissolution of the kinetochore microtubules and the continuous elongation of the polar microtubules occurs at telophase.

The study of _____ is called metrology. This study is important to accurate analytical methods and calculations.
zhenek [66]

Answer:

measurement

Explanation:

Metrology is the scientific study of measurement. .The first being the definition of units of measurement, second the realisation of these units of measurement in practice, and last traceability, which is linking measurements made in practice to the reference standards.
